只为小站
首页
域名查询
文件下载
登录
使用
弹簧
质子模型制作的布料仿真程序.zip
在计算机图形学领域,布料仿真是一种常见的技术,用于创建逼真的虚拟衣物和材料效果。本项目使用“
弹簧
质子模型”来实现这种仿真,这是一种模拟物体物理特性的方法,尤其适用于模拟柔软、可变形的物体如布料。下面将详细介绍
弹簧
质点模型及其在布料仿真实现中的应用。
弹簧
质点模型是基于物理的模拟系统,其核心思想是将物体视为由许多相互连接的质点组成,这些质点之间通过
弹簧
进行连接,模拟物体的弹性。每个质点代表物体的一个小部分,而
弹簧
则模拟了质点间的相互作用力,包括拉力和压力,以保持物体的形状和响应外力。 在布料仿真中,每个质点都有自己的质量和位置,它们之间的连接可以通过几种不同类型的
弹簧
来定义,如拉伸
弹簧
、剪切
弹簧
和弯曲
弹簧
。拉伸
弹簧
负责保持质点之间的距离,当质点被拉开时会产生恢复力;剪切
弹簧
防止质点在垂直于连接线的方向上偏移,保持表面平整;弯曲
弹簧
则用于模拟布料的曲率和皱褶,使布料在受到扭曲时能自然地折叠和展开。 在实际编程实现中,首先需要设置质点的初始位置和连接关系,然后通过数值求解器(如Euler方法或更稳定的辛方法)迭代计算每个时间步中每个质点的受力和运动状态。同时,还需要考虑其他因素,如重力、风力、碰撞检测等,以增加模拟的真实感。 在本项目中,“simulation”可能包含了一系列的源代码文件和资源文件,用于构建和运行这个布料仿真实验。这些文件可能包括: 1. 主程序代码:用C++、Python或其他编程语言实现,包含质点系统和
弹簧
网络的初始化,以及物理模拟的核心算法。 2. 数据结构:定义质点和
弹簧
的类或结构体,存储它们的位置、速度、质量、连接信息等。 3. 求解器:实现数值积分算法,更新质点的状态。 4. 图形渲染:使用OpenGL、Unity或其他图形库,将模拟结果实时显示出来。 5. 输入输出:可能有配置文件用于设置初始条件,以及日志或结果文件保存模拟数据。 6. 碰撞检测:处理质点与其他物体或场景边界碰撞的逻辑。 7. 用户界面:提供交互式控制,比如改变重力方向、施加外部力等。 通过这个项目,开发者可以深入理解物理模拟的基本原理,学习如何将复杂的物理模型转化为有效的计算机算法,并通过可视化将这些模拟过程展示出来。这对于游戏开发、电影特效、工业设计等领域都非常有用,能够帮助创造出更加真实的虚拟世界。
2024-08-02 20:43:49
2.6MB
1
弹簧
设计软件
用于各种拉簧、压簧的重量、力值、等等等等的计算工具,非常不错
2024-06-22 09:33:40
867KB
弹簧设计软件
1
弹簧
质量阻尼系统的MPC控制算法仿真m文件源码
用MPC算法来控制
弹簧
质量阻尼系统。首先建立
弹簧
质量阻尼系统的模型,然后将连续时间模型转换成离散模型,推倒预测和优化方程,将控制问题转化成标准二次型问题,分别使用解析法和数值法两种优化求解方式,最后用Matlab进行了单位阶跃响应MPC控制仿真。配合博客:模型预测控制(MPC)九:
弹簧
质量阻尼的MPC仿真,在matlab 2016a实测可运行
2024-05-23 20:20:26
2KB
matlab
MPC
模型预测控制
无极绳单轨吊离心限速器的结构设计
针对单轨吊正常工作过程中,离心限速器的滑块带动
弹簧
左右窜动、稳定性差等缺点,设计了一种新型稳定限位的离心限速器,该装置通过平衡滑块离心力与
弹簧
张紧力的稳定设计,有效地防止滑块在单轨吊运行时左右窜动,提高离心限速器的稳定性、安全性;对离心限速器中重要的部件(即拉伸
弹簧
)的选取,准确确定定位板焊接的位置、内六角螺栓的初始位置,为以后该装置的工作调试提供参考。
2024-02-28 23:46:38
243KB
弹簧选型
1
振动筛橡胶
弹簧
力学参数试验测定
为深入了解振动筛橡胶
弹簧
的力学性能,采用试验方法对振动筛橡胶
弹簧
的刚度、阻尼系数、阻尼比等力学参数进行测定,测定结果表明:橡胶
弹簧
的线性与非线性刚度的区分点为其10%变形量;不同的加载速度对橡胶
弹簧
线性阶段刚度影响较小,对非线性刚度影响较大,且呈线性增长的趋势;橡胶
弹簧
刚度越大,其阻尼系数及动态阻尼比越小,试验测定橡胶
弹簧
阻尼系数为0.031132~0.036892,动态阻尼比为0.046833~0.062062。
2024-02-26 12:16:55
622KB
行业研究
1
matlab代码sqrt-Mass-Spring-Damper-Python-Demo:解决正弦输入下阻尼质量和
弹簧
系统的响应
Matlab代码sqrt 质量
弹簧
阻尼器Python演示 该代码解决了正弦输入下dDamped质量和
弹簧
系统的响应。 解决的示例可以在以下位置找到 系统模式:质量通过
弹簧
和阻尼器连接到刚性地面,力输入为fo * sin(wt) 将其转换为状态空间可得出q_dot = Aq + Bu y = Cq + Du k = 100牛顿/米m = 1千克阻尼比= 0.1 omega_n = np.sqrt(k / m)c = zeta 2 np.sqrt(m * k) A = [[0,1],[-k / m,-c / m]] B = [[0],[1]] C = [[1,0]]这将选择位移作为我们的输出 D = 0
2023-04-09 20:12:38
55KB
系统开源
1
基于
弹簧
阻尼模型的碰撞动力学研究 (2012年)
基于碰撞过程特点建立了
弹簧
阻尼模型,结合能量关系和恢复系数法对
弹簧
阻尼模型进行理论公式推导,得出完整的解析解;对ADAMS中的冲击函数模型进行仿真研究,并与理论计算结果进行对比;最后分析了恢复系数对计算结果的影响。研究表明:理论模型计算过程比较复杂;在恢复系数大于0.7时,冲击函数模型可以得到较好的仿真结果。
2023-04-09 10:06:20
2.22MB
工程技术
论文
1
聚辉
弹簧
产品手册.pdf
聚辉
弹簧
产品手册.pdf
2023-04-04 16:59:31
3.35MB
机械
设计
制造
1
基于ADAMS/Vibration模块振动筛隔振
弹簧
优化设计
基于ADAMS/Vibration模块振动筛隔振
弹簧
优化设计,李增彬,程珩,本文采用多自由度隔振系统的动力学分析方法, 讨论了隔振
弹簧
的性能参数对系统隔振性能的影响;在多体动力学软件上建立了振动筛隔�
2023-02-28 12:41:10
776KB
首发论文
1
利用python求解物理学中的双
弹簧
质能系统详解
主要给大家介绍了关于利用python如何求解物理学中的双
弹簧
质能系统的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。
2023-02-24 13:47:47
115KB
实验物理
python
python计算物理
python物理引擎
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
多智能体的编队控制matlab程序(自己编写的,可以运行)
多机器人编队及避障仿真算法.zip
IBM CPLEX 12.10 学术版 mac操作系统安装包
YOLOv5 人脸口罩图片数据集
雷达信号处理仿真程序(MTI,MTD等)
matpower5.0b1.zip
Spring相关的外文文献和翻译(毕设论文必备)
Android小项目——新闻APP(源码)
华为OD机试真题.pdf
2020年数学建模国赛C题论文
全国道路网SHP数据.zip
2010年-2020中国地面气候资料数据集(V3.0)
Academic+Phrasebank+2021+Edition+_中英文对照.pdf
大唐杯资料+题库(移动通信)
Alternative A2DP Driver 1.0.5.1 无限制版
最新下载
IPD教材(华为产品持续集成的管理流程)
中文版Access 2016宝典(第8版), 文字版,全标签,已划重点,已加注释
计算文件SM3,MD5, SHA1,SHA256摘要值工具
华为IPD模式中跨部门团队成员的考核激励制度.doc
华为IPD流程实战培训
KCF目标跟踪C++代码
计算机网络考研期末知识点总结
HUAWEI_NEW_IPD流程管理_详细版.pptx
甘肃省界shp文件
TensorRT-7.0.0.11.Windows10.x86_64.cuda-10.0.cudnn7.6.zip
其他资源
LSTM-Matlab代码
xilinx-2011.09-50-arm-xilinx-linux-gnueabi.bin
matlab 高斯过程回归模型 matlab Gaussian process regression model
基于STM32F407的PS2遥控手柄代码
基于mysql,java swing的酒店管理系统源码
vivado_lic2037.lic
进程外com组件实现win764位软件调用32位库
深入性能测试LoadRunner性能测试,流程,监控,调优全程实战剖析.pdf
安妮LOL解机器码.rar
微信提示请在微信客户端登陆css
10 DCT变换对灰度图像压缩案例matlab程序.zip
C#ImageEnhance图像增强
51单片机用C语言取出奇偶校验位
利用.NET3.0技术构建互操作保险系统
Insomnia.Core-2020.5.2.exe
ArtnetnodeWifi:Arduino库,用于通过WiFi的Art-Net-Node(artnet),处理DMX数据并响应轮询请求。 在ESP8266,ESP32,WiFi101和WiFiNINA设备上运行-源码
KISVoucher.zip
基于VC++的信号发生器
自己编写的E00读写程序
fps200指纹识别模块技术手册
复旦大学专用集成电路与系统实验室的ASIC讲义
直接保存对象到数据库Demo
带权图的多种算法(有向图,无向图,Dijkstra算法,到每个顶点的最短距离算法,佛洛依德算法(Floyd),找出每对顶点的最短路径,带权重无向图最小生成树,prim算法,Kruskal算法求最小生成树)java实现,有注释
射频微电子学 非常经典的书籍
鼠标拖动的实现
diskgen3.0windows版(硬盘分区工具)